GSPC turns into mercenary group spurred on by money
Money and terrorism
Algerian security services have opened in-depth investigations into the origin of the lavish property recently acquired by many families of newly-recruited terrorists affiliated to the Salafist group for preaching and combat –GSPC-.
-
Most of these “newly-rich families”, now under police scrutiny, are settled in the provinces of Tizi Ouzou and Boumerdes, east of Algiers.
-
A source close to the ongoing investigation told “Echorouk El Yaoumi” that the GSPC chieftains had been using money, wrenched in ransoms and racketeering, to lure young recruits into joining the terrorist ranks.
-
Some of the young recruits’ families are believed to have benefited from this “dirty” financial bonanza covertly provided by the GSPC command.
-
The recruiting terrorist agents hoodwinked these misled youngsters into joining the GSPC terrorist groups by taking advantage of their precarious socio-economic situation.
-
According to repentant terrorists, money has become a source of a bitter wrangle within the terrorist groups.
